Hexthorpe sits right on the western edge of the town centre, wedged between the railway lines and the River Don, with Balby on one side and the town on the other. From our kitchen on Copley Road it is one of the shortest runs we do - a few minutes by car. We deliver across the whole of Hexthorpe, from the streets around Hexthorpe Road through to the houses backing onto the park, with no minimum order.
It is a tight-knit area with real history - the old Great Northern railway works shaped it, and Hexthorpe Flatts has been the local green space for well over a century. For a quick Thai delivery cooked fresh to order, we are about as close as it gets.

Head Chef Rin has cooked Thai food across South Yorkshire for over a decade - Thai Garden Cafe in Manvers, a stint at Khao Niew in Barnsley, then the kitchen at Happy Cha Bubble Tea before opening Charm Thai Cafe on Copley Road. The curry pastes are imported direct from Thailand, the same Mae Ploy pastes used in Bangkok kitchens, but the sauces, stocks, Pad Thai sauce, satay sauce, the spring rolls and dumplings are all made in our kitchen.
Every dish is cooked to order, and because Hexthorpe is so close, the food barely has time to settle before it reaches you. If you want authentic Thai food cooked properly rather than rushed, this is the kitchen for it.
